What Is Threads Badge Meaning on Instagram?
Threads badge on Instagram is a sign showing a special connection between your Instagram profile and the Threads app. When you see this badge, it means you’ve linked the two platforms.

What is Threads badge number meaning?
As you might look at your Threads profile, you might start wondering: why my Threads badge has no number? But, don’t worry! Threads badge number, which has now been removed, used to show how many people signed up for Threads before them.
Is the Threads badge temporary?
Yes, as mentioned earlier, the numbered badge on Threads has been removed. However, you can still see the app’s logo at the top of your Instagram profile, and the best part is that you have the option to hide it if you’d like.
How to see the Threads badge number?
Although the badge number is not visible on your Instagram bio, you can see it and it’s not a secret! Just open your Instagram profile and tap the three-line icon at the top right corner. Select “Threads” and a screen will be displayed, showing your badge number.
How to add Threads badge to Instagram bio?
Once you create a profile on Threads, you’ll get the badge automatically on your Instagram bio. You can choose either to keep it or hide it from your Instagram profile.
How to hide Threads badge on Instagram profile?
No worries if you don’t want the Threads logo shows up at the top of your Instagram profile. You have two simple ways to remove it:
- Just open your Instagram profile, long-press the icon, and then tap remove.
Or;
On your Instagram profile, tap Edit profile, and turn off the toggle next to the “Show Threads shortcut”.
How to get Threads badge back on Instagram?
You may change your mind and want to know how to unhide Threads badge on Instagram. It’s just as simple as hiding it. Here we show you the steps to how to add a Threads badge to Instagram after removing it.
- head over to your Instagram profile;
- Tap on Edit profile;
- Turn the Shortcut toggle on.

What is the difference between the Threads logo and the Threads badge?
The Threads logo on Instagram is the app’s icon or symbol located at the top of the user’s Instagram profile.
On the other hand, the Threads badge was a feature that used to show the number of users who signed up for Threads before a specific user.
Can I see my followers’ badges on their Instagram profiles?
Yes, if they don’t hide the badge, it will be visible to all other users on Instagram.
Is the Threads badge available for all Instagram users?
While it’s available for all Instagram users in more than 100 countries, Threads is not accessible in European Union countries due to local regulations.
